As a kind of basic technology in image engineering, image segmentation is crucial to many fields such as Machine Vision and Object-Oriented Multimedia technology. Image segmentation has broad applications in nearly all areas related to image. Image object segmentation which is to extract the interesting object from its clutter background in an image is the highest goal of image segmentation. Therefore, the study on the theories and related technologies of image object segmentation is quite meaningful.Aiming at extracting the interesting object in images, this thesis analyses and summarizes some related theories and methods. In this thesis, we first compartmentalize the goal of image segmentation based on the analysis of its definition. Through the wide study on image segmentation methods, we find that the top-down segment process which utilizes the prior knowledge of the object is an effective method of image object segmentation.According to the above conception, we investigate an image segmentation method based on class-specific fragment, called CSF-SEG for short, which belongs to the top-down processes. In this method, the construction of an object by fragments is somewhat similar to the assembly of a jigsaw puzzle, where we try to put together a set of pieces such that their templates form an image similar to a given example. However, there are some problems in the original method, such as low availability of the extracted fragments, error position of the match results, and high complexity of the algorithm etc. In this thesis, a novel method to extract fragments is proposed, and it improves the availability of the extracted fragments; a novel match method called HER is also proposed, which is a Hybrid one combining the object's Edge and Region features, and its advancement is showed in the experimental results; a prototypal top-down image object segmentation system named IO-SEG is devised and implemented in this thesis, which is based on class-specific fragment and integrates the methods proposed in this thesis.
